If you already ice fish and have a portable, your only real investment should be a spear to start out anyway. I haven't done it many times, but when I have, we used a portable sled, drilled our spear hole with an auger, and lowered a hookless husky jerk down the hole attached to a leader with a 3 oz weight tied to it on the bottom. and we smoked the hell out of them. it was a blast. And if I remember right, the first time i went my buddy had gone out to his garden shed and found an old heavy ice chipper and ground down 5 points and threw it in the box. it was about as redneck as it gets, but holy smokes did it hook me.
